The Evolution of Slot Machine Technology

Traditional mechanical slot machines operated purely on physical mechanisms—hardware that included spinning reels, levers, and predefined payout schemes. However, with the advent of electronic and online slots, the gameplay now hinges on sophisticated random number generators (RNGs). These algorithms simulate the randomness of physical reels and ensure equitable game outcomes, which has risen as a crucial concern for regulators and players alike.

Core Principles of Fairness in Slot Gaming

At the heart of fair slot gameplay are principles like transparency, unpredictability, and unbiased randomness. Regulatory bodies worldwide, such as the UK Gambling Commission and Malta Gaming Authority, require operators to implement certified RNGs and undergo regular audits to validate their fairness claims.

Key Aspect Description Industry Standards
Randomness Ensuring outcomes are unpredictable and cannot be tampered with. Certified RNGs with periodic audits by independent testing agencies
Transparency Providing players with information about the fairness mechanisms. Clear payout percentages and independent verification
Security Protecting the integrity of the game from external interference. Secure encryption and tamper-proof hardware/software

The Role of Sequential Reel Stoppage in Player Experience

One interesting mechanic in many online slots, especially those inspired by traditional machines, is the way reels stop during a spin. Unlike purely random spins where all wheels halt simultaneously, some games implement a sequential stopping pattern that can influence player perception and engagement. This method involves stopping the reels one by one from left to right, creating suspense and a sense of control.

“The way reels stop can significantly impact player psychology, affecting perceived fairness and the thrill of the game.” — Industry Expert Analysis

This brings us to a particularly noteworthy technique seen in both experimental and commercial slot designs: the mechanism described as “Walzen stoppen nacheinander von links”, or “rolls stopping sequentially from the left”. Essentially, the game engine initiates reel stoppage automatically, from left to right, after a predefined delay, contributing to a dramatic reveal that appeals to player emotions even if the outcome remains determined by RNG.

Technical Insights: How Sequential Reel Stopping Enhances User Engagement

From a technical standpoint, controlled reel stop sequences serve dual purposes:

  • Player Perception of Fairness: The suspense created aligns with psychological principles like the “illusion of control”. Even if outcomes are random, watching reels stop sequentially can give players the impression of influence over results.
  • Game Design Aesthetics: Developers utilize this technique to craft engaging narratives within their slots, making game outcomes appear more dramatic and rewarding.

Implementing such sequences involves precise timing controls within the game’s software architecture, often synchronized with audiovisual cues to heighten anticipation.
